Q3 Planning Note — Brindlecore Analytics

Sales leads: we launch the Summit tier in week 2 of Q3. Positioning: above Pro, bundles the Lanternview dashboards and priority onboarding. Target: accounts over 200 seats. Discounting capped at 10% without VP approval. Enablement deck lands Friday. Rationale and roadmap detail are restricted and appear below.

internal memo for kawip-hadug: Headcount on the Wenwyn team goes from 7 to 140 by the end of January. Gross margin on Wenwyn came in at 20 percent against a plan of 15 percent.

Welcome to the Pricefetch service! Quick heads-up: we wrap every call to the upstream Tariffwise API in a circuit breaker. After five consecutive failures it opens for 30 seconds, so don't panic if you see fallback pricing in the logs — that's by design. Config lives in breaker.yaml. When you cut a release of this service, sign the bundle with the key below.

release key, kawif-hawep: bky13_X7TGuRG4Zu4ZJ

## Runbook: Session-token refresh bug (Kestrelgate)

Kestrelgate has a known race where tokens refreshed within five seconds of expiry are occasionally rejected by the validator, logging users out mid-session. The mitigation is to widen the refresh window and lengthen the grace period until the 4.2 patch ships. Release managers should verify these overrides are present in every release candidate before promotion, since the defaults regress the fix. The required override values are as follows.

deployment values, yadug-bawif:
[framir]
team = pelox
access_code = ac_a38ab2
owner = tamion.julael
host = framir.tolvaqlabs.test
port = 11211
peer = tammir.zemvargrid.local
salt = 2215ef03
pin = 1541